Food Distribution
Our free food distribution program provides essential groceries to individuals and families facing food insecurity, offering regular access to nutritious items and vital community support. Through our year-round Connections program, we also supply emergency food, school supplies, diapers, and formula across the DFW Metroplex. In addition, we host large seasonal events during Thanksgiving and Christmas, providing full holiday meals and extended groceries to LMI families through strong partnerships with local schools, churches, and agencies.
